Heritage Valley Sewickley School of Nursing's goal is to provide the highest quality educational program. Students are expected to adhere to high standards of personal and professional conduct. This includes appropriateness of dress, respect for self and for others, cooperation, dependability, confidentiality, accountability, integrity and commitment.
Policies to promote a drug-free environment prohibit the unlawful manufacture, distribution, dispensing, possession or use of illicit drugs and alcohol in all School of Nursing and Heritage Valley Health System premises, clinical affiliations, and any related activities.
Heritage Valley Sewickley School of Nursing reserves the right to dismiss any student whose academic achievement, health, conduct or nursing practice makes it inadvisable to permit continued enrollment in the program.
The faculty reserves the right to change academic and program policies. The student body will be notified of the changes in writing. Special recommendations may be made by faculty pertaining to individual students.
